Job Description

Description

We are seeking a Hardware Asset Configuration Manager to support our NORAD-NORTHCOM (N&NC) IT Enterprise Services (NITES) Program. Our customer maintains a highly demanding mission and requires our support to provide expert technical and professional management support to the command’s enterprise Information Technology (IT) services. The Hardware Asset Configuration Manager will support a program that provides sustainment, maintenance, Problem and Change management services to help ensure secure, reliable, and uninterrupted availability of the Department of Defense IP networks.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Independently Manage Hardware Assets: Operate as the sole point of contact (POC) for hardware asset configuration management with minimal oversight. Handle all activities related to current and new hardware assets requested to be added to the Configuration Management Database (CMDB).
  • Maintain Hardware Catalog Accuracy: Develop, maintain, and ensure the accuracy of the hardware catalog in relation to the master hardware inventory. This inventory should reflect all hardware currently in use on the N&NC networks.
  • Track and Manage Hardware Licensing and Warranty: Monitor hardware licensing and warranty to prevent over-utilization of controlled hardware products. Provide documentation for metadata to hardware and licensing/warranty requirements and update status on current license/warranty accounts.
  • Analyze Enterprise Architecture: Evaluate existing Enterprise Architecture products to develop, update, and maintain baseline configuration management artifacts and metadata for systems supporting N&NC mission sets and critical processes.
  • Manage Hardware Lifecycle: Oversee the hardware lifecycle to ensure concurrent hardware versioning to reduce vulnerabilities on the network and promote cybersecurity standards.
  • Oversee Hardware SACM Processes: Ensure that hardware components (Configuration Items) forming delivered services are identified, baselined, and maintained on both the operational network and in the hardware catalog. Ensure service release into controlled environments and operational use are based on formal approval, and maintain accurate configuration information on historical, planned, and current hardware for all systems and services used by the Government customer.
  • Brief Hardware Changes: Present hardware changes at the Configuration Advisory Board (CAB) meetings attended by the Government Customer to receive approvals for changes.
  • Research and Procure Hardware: Research hardware to create Bill of Materials for the acquisitions team. Produce Bill of Materials for Government Furnished Equipment (GFE) purchases, research and determine appropriate hardware to maintain functionality after items have gone end of life/sale, and research hardware to verify suitability for network inclusion and addition into CMDB. Provide technical evaluation of vendor quotes for accuracy prior to contract awards.
  • Create and Maintain Reports: Generate and maintain Monthly Definitive Media Library Reports and Semi-Annual Microsoft True-Up Reports. Maintain hardware assets and license documentation in at least two definitive media libraries (DMLs). Draft deliverables in accordance with contract requirements such as lifecycle technical refresh plans or other required documents.
  • Engage with Stakeholders: Work directly with Government customers, internal customers, team members (other functional areas), and management to update, maintain, and edit the Approved Hardware Catalog. Conduct cost-benefit analysis research to provide best-fit hardware solutions for customer requests, and understand the issues, develop solutions, and determine appropriate hardware to fulfill service requests, break-fix requests, hardware requests, and ongoing technical issues resolution efforts.
  • Support Software Asset Configuration Management: As an alternate, support software asset configuration management by updating and maintaining the approved Software (SW) catalog and relevant SACM SW processes/procedures/duties/responsibilities.
  • Collaboration with Change Management: Work closely with change management and may act as alternate change manager in absence of the primary.
